There are 3 repositories under constant-time topic.
Constant-Time Character Encoding in PHP Projects
Templated type-safe hashmap implementation in C using open addressing and linear probing for collision resolution.
Constantine: modular, high-performance, zero-dependency cryptography stack for proof systems and blockchain protocols.
Pure-Rust traits and utilities for constant-time cryptographic implementations.
Constant-complexity deterministic memory allocator (heap) for hard real-time high-integrity embedded systems. There is very little activity because the project is finished and does not require further changes.
A set of cryptographic primitives for building a multi-hop Proxy Re-encryption scheme, known as Transform Encryption.
A simple value-sorted map type for Go that features constant-time reads and efficient iteration over records.
CRYPTOGAMS distribution repository
Constant-time JavaScript functions
high performance AES implementations optimized for cortex-m microcontrollers
Rust finite field library with fixed size multi-word values
Safe Base64 encoding/decoding in pure JavaScript.
Constant-time hex and base64 codecs from libsodium reimplemented in Rust.
A repository of tools for verifying constant-timeness
Iodine: Verifying Constant-Time Execution of Hardware
Artifact associated with CHES 2022 paper https://tches.iacr.org/index.php/TCHES/article/view/9817
A bump allocator that uses fixed-size chunks to ensure non-amortized O(1) allocations
A typed arena that uses fixed-size chunks to ensure non-amortized O(1) allocations
RESTful API to calculate real-time statistic from the last 60 seconds.
Dictionary App backend project. Features custom built dictionary data structure that allows for O(1) insertion, search, and delete on a Java server with HTTPS req/res capabilites
Testing the Rust crypto library orion with dudect-bencher